Wat Chiang Mien
Wat Chiang Mien
: Michelin's recommendations
Wat Chiang Mien was built by the city’s founder, King Mengrai, which makes it the oldest temple in Chiang Mai (13C). Thais come here to honour the two treasures housed in the temple. A very old rock-crystal statuette of Buddha, which is said to have rain-making powers (the inhabitants of Chiang Mai process with the Buddha every year in April just before the monsoon), and an 8C walking Buddha, which was a gift from Sri Lankan monks to the monarch. Once again, the wood carvings in this temple are remarkable.
